Subject: RateSentry 4.2 ready for staging

Hi release team — the parity-checker cut is done. This build fixes the double-counting of corporate rates on the Willowmere channel and adds the new currency-rounding tolerance flag, defaulting to off. Regression suite passed on all three partner feeds. Please schedule the staging push for Thursday. The candidate is identified by the token below.

pipeline stamp: htk21_104c5ba7d0df6b2897cd5

Alert: thumbgen-queue-depth-high. The Pictora thumbnail generation queue exceeded 10k pending jobs for 15+ minutes. Usual causes: bulk uploads from the Marlow importer, or worker pods stuck on corrupt image headers. Impact is delayed previews, not data loss. Mitigation: scale the render pool to 12 workers and purge jobs older than 6 hours. Fired three times this week, always during the evening ingest window — worth discussing ownership at sync. Triage steps and historical occurrences are tracked on the page below.

dashboard of kafop-yagep = https://jira.zemvarsys.internal/pages/pages/pages/display/cc87

Heads up on the TilePorter prefetcher pipeline: nightly CI kept choking on the zoom-level cache warmup step, and it turned out the Arlevine mirror was serving stale manifests. We pinned the manifest snapshot and reran — all green now. Nothing blocks the cut for this week's release. For the changelog, grab the token from the line right below this note.

pipeline stamp: htk4_ae36

## Spreadsheet Export Memory Notes

Welcome to the Tablewick team. Large spreadsheet exports stream through the internal Sheetforge service to keep worker memory flat, so never buffer full workbooks locally. Sheetforge requires an authenticated session for every export request. The shared service key you will need appears below.

app token of badug-tahaf = qvz11-nP5FBNr8qnh